APLIKASI KECERDASAN BUATAN DAN PEMAHAMAN MESIN DALAM PERTANIAN URBAN: TINJAUAN SISTEMATIS DAN PERSPEKTIF MASA DEPAN Iskandar Umarie; Muhammad Hazmi; Oktarina; Fiana Podesta

Abstract

This study aims to conduct a systematic and comprehensive literature review on the applications of artificial intelligence and machine learning in vertical farming, focusing on technology optimization, economic aspects, and environmental sustainability. The method used is a systematic literature review (SLR) of open-access academic publications from reputable international databases such as Scopus, Web of Science, and Google Scholar, with a publication timeframe spanning the last five years (2018-2023). The review results indicate that the most widely applied soilless cultivation technologies are hydroponics, aeroponics, and aquaponics, with aeroponics demonstrating the highest water use efficiency. The integration of IoT, smart sensors, and AI can increase crop productivity; however, the carbon footprint of these systems is highly dependent on the energy source used. The main barriers to adoption are high initial investment and operational energy costs. This article contributes to updating and expanding the understanding of the applications of artificial intelligence and machine learning in vertical farming, as well as identifying research gaps and proposing directions for technology and policy development oriented towards sustainability and profitability
Efektivitas Dosis dan Waktu Pemberian Agen Hayati Trichoderma harzianum Terhadap Penyakit layu Fusarium dan Hasil Tanaman Tomat (Solanum lycopersicum L.) Dina Adelia Rahmawati; Oktarina; Insan Wijaya

Abstract

Penelitian ini bertujuan untuk efektivitas dosis dan waktu pemberian agen hayati Trichoderma harzianum terhadap penyakit layu Fusarium dan hasil tanaman tomat (Solanum lycopersicum L.). Penelitian ini dilaksanakan di Desa Kesilir Kecamatan Wuluhan Kabupaten Jember. Pada Desember hingga Maret. Penelitian ini menggunakan Rancangan Acak Kelompok (RAK) yang terddiri dari dua faktor yaitu dosis Trichoderma harzianum (T) dalam 3 taraf yaitu: T0 = kontrol, T1 = 15 gram/tanaman, T2 = 20 gram/tanaman. Dan waktu pemberian Trichoderma harzianum (P) dalam 3 taraf yaitu: P1 = 1 hst P2 = 5 hst P3 = 10 hst. Analisa data menggunakan analisis ragam dan jika berpengaruh nyata dilanjutkan dengan menggunakan uji jarak berganda Duncan (DMRT) taraf 5%. Hasil penelitian menunjukkan perlakuan dosis Trichoderma harzianum perlakuan T2 berpengaruh nyata dan merupakan perlakuan terbaik pada perlakuan jumlah buah bagus pertanaman, jumlah buah bagus per plot, berat buah bagus pertanaman dan berat buah bagus per plot. Perlakuan waktu pemberian Trichoderma harzianum perlakuan P2 berpengaruh nyata dan merupakan perlakuan terbaik pada jumlah buah bagus pertanaman, jumlah buah bagus perplot berat buah bagus pertanaman dan berat buah bagus perplot
